MKL v Telford 23/10/10

A superb empty net goal a second from the final buzzer rounded off a 4-1 victory against Telford Tigers at the Thunderdome.

With nothing to lose after Tigers withdrew keeper Martin Clarkson for the extra skater with 1min 2secs remaining, Leigh Jamieson just outside Alex Mettam’s crease took the goalie’s pass and blasted the puck up ice. When Andre Smulter redirected the puck Tigers defence had no chance of stopping it hit the back of the net.

Lightning had looked to be in for a fairly easy night when Gary Clarke passed from behind the net for Andre Smulter to beat Clarkson after 3mins 20secs and the same pair of players produced the second goal at 17mins 5secs.
On that occasion Smulter fired in with Clarkson failing to hold the puck and Clarke shot home on the rebound.

It was not until the 35th minute that referee Dan Boardman called the first penalty, by then Tigers had been buoyed by a goal from the blue line by Chris Allen at 30mins 30secs.

They seemed to step up their game for the remainder of the period but were unable to add to their score.

It took until 49mins 14secs for Adam Carr to somehow squeeze the puck past Clarkson to make it 3-1.

There was a moment of mini drama when Michael Wales and Tom Watkins exchanged fists with just over a minute to go – a result of niggling incidents earlier in the game – but it did not amount to much with minor penalties dished out.

Almost immediately Clarkson went off to allow an extra skater and Lightning rounded off with the empty net goal.
